Synopsis

The most elegant and subtle of books to give and to have, this title evokes the English gardens of Sara Midda's childhood, sowing the imagination with glorious images. Dozens and dozens of illustrations and tender reflections recall a hut in the wood, or a topiary maze, a summer day spent podding peas, or an herb patch that yields Biblical fragrances. Ruby-red radishes are the jewels of the underworld. Myriad colors fall upon warm green moss. Painted with Sara Midda's fine brush, it is a book of lasting enchantment.

About the Author

Sara Midda is an artist and author. Her previous books include the international best sellers HOW TO BUILD AN A and SARA MIDDA'S SOUTH OF FRANCE. She has exhibited her work in London galleries, and her designs are used in a full line of lifestyle products in Japan. She lives outside London and in the South of France

From the Back Cover

This books is a potpourri of garden lore. Here are summer days of raspberry picking, swarms of bees laden with pollen, peas ripe for podding, herbs for flavouring. Every page, including the text, has been hand painted. Dip into it for recipes, poems, proverbs, and garden thoughts.
